Advanced solid-state memory is a type of computer memory system that has no moving parts and is stored within a hardware device. Some of the widely used solid-state memory technologies are Static Random Access Memory (SRAM), Dynamic Random Access Memory (DRAM) and flash. These technologies are combined to form a universal memory with the selected properties of SRAM, DRAM and flash.
